首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在HTML中通过JS将图像的src赋值给变量

在HTML中,可以通过JavaScript将图像的src赋值给变量。具体步骤如下:

  1. 首先,在HTML文件中创建一个img元素,用于显示图像:
代码语言:txt
复制
<img id="myImage" src="path/to/image.jpg" alt="My Image">
  1. 接下来,在JavaScript中获取该img元素,并将其src属性的值赋给一个变量:
代码语言:txt
复制
var image = document.getElementById("myImage");
var srcValue = image.src;

在上述代码中,我们使用getElementById方法获取id为"myImage"的img元素,并将其赋值给变量image。然后,通过访问image对象的src属性,将图像的src值赋给变量srcValue。

这样,变量srcValue就存储了图像的src值,可以在后续的代码中使用。

关于HTML、JavaScript以及图像处理的更多信息,您可以参考以下腾讯云产品和文档:

  1. HTML:HTML是一种用于创建网页的标记语言,用于定义网页的结构和内容。您可以参考腾讯云的HTML开发文档,了解更多HTML相关知识:HTML开发文档
  2. JavaScript:JavaScript是一种用于为网页添加交互功能的脚本语言。您可以参考腾讯云的JavaScript开发文档,了解更多JavaScript相关知识:JavaScript开发文档
  3. 图像处理:腾讯云提供了丰富的图像处理服务,包括图像上传、处理、识别等功能。您可以参考腾讯云的图像处理产品,了解更多图像处理相关知识:腾讯云图像处理产品

请注意,以上提供的是腾讯云相关产品和文档的链接,仅供参考。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

为了防止狗上沙发,写了一个浏览器实时识别目标功能

摄像头视频流转化成视频帧图像传给模型进行识别 录制一个音频 识别到目标(狗)后播放音频 需要部署一个设备上 找一个不用旧手机,Android 系统 安装 termux 来实现开启本地 http...但是,家里夫人直接做了一个围栏晚上狗圈起来了 实现总结 该方案通过以下步骤实现了一个基于网页实时物体检测系统,专门用于识别画面狗并播放特定音频以驱赶它离开沙发。...加载物体检测模型: 使用 TensorFlow.js 和预训练 COCO-SSD MobileNet V2 模型进行对象检测,加载模型后赋值 dogDetector 变量。...当前视频帧绘制到 canvas 上,然后从 canvas 中提取图像数据传入模型进行预测。模型返回预测结果,如果检测到“dog”,则触发播放音频函数。...上传项目文件至 Termux 目录下并通过访问 localhost:8000 启动应用。 通过以上技术整合,最终实现了旧手机上部署一个能够实时检测画面网页应用,并在检测到狗时播放指定音频。

7410

WebGL简易教程(一):第一个简单示例

正好最近我研究GIS地形绘制,那么我就通过一步一步绘制地形示例,来总结WebGL相关知识。...是HTML5引入一个绘制标签,可以画布绘制任意图形。WebGL正是通过元素进行绘制。 除此之外,这段代码还通过标签引入了几个外部JS文件。...通过着色器程序,三维图像渲染就更加灵活强大。 initShaders()函数,传入了预先定义JS字符串VSHADER_SOURCE和FSHADER_SOURCE。...既然是语言也就有自己函数与变量定义。main()函数是每个着色器程序定义入口。main函数顶点坐标赋值内置变量gl_Position,点尺寸赋值内置变量gl_PointSize。...1.0, 0.0, 0.0, 1.0);\n' + // Set the point color '}\n'; 如同顶点着色器一样,片元着色器颜色赋值gl_FragColor变量,gl_FragColor

1.7K10

前端学习之路-CSS介绍,Html介绍,JavaScript介绍

html为超文本标记语言,通过标签来定义语言,代码不用区分大小写。...引入: JavaScript脚本代码嵌入到HTML文档 标记对之间放置 标记对之间放置 变量 变量名以字母或下划线("_")开头 变量可以包含数字、从 A 至 Z 大小写字母 JavaScript...区分大小写 变量声明和赋值 定义变量:var name; 赋值:name = dashucoding; 常量 整型 浮点型 字符串型 数据类型 弱类型,区分大小写 数值型 整型、浮点型 字符串型...in 对象){ 语句; } 结语 本文主要讲解 前端学习之路-CSS介绍,Html介绍,JavaScript介绍 下面我继续对Java、 Android其他知识 深入讲解 ,有兴趣可以继续关注

1.8K20

写给零基础小白网站开发入门

看完本教程,你学会: 理解HTML、CSS、JS各自作用 学习HTML、CSS、JS基本语法 能写一个简单网页 为快速上手练习,可以使用在线编辑器,学会基础语法后,再下载专业网站开发编辑器/开发环境...1.2 属性 在上面的代码,你可能发现,有些标签除了标签名,还有其他内容,比如: 图像标签src是img标签属性。...语法如下: #id值 { ... } 可以下面css代码应用到上述html内容两个盒子不同背景颜色: #box1 { background: red;...语法如下: .class值 { ... } 可以下面css代码应用到上述html内容所有box盒子添加相同背景色: .box { background: red...下面介绍JS基本语法: JS,单行注释用 // 注释内容 表示,多行注释用 / 注释内容 / 表示 3.2.1 基本语法 JS是弱类型语言,通过let关键字,能定义一个变量,支持传入各种类型(整数、

2.6K51

JavaScript 基础

,用来结构化我们网页内容和赋予内容含义,例如定义段落、标题,或是页面嵌入图片和视频CSS 是一种样式规则语言,我们样式应用于我们 HTML 内容, 例如设置背景颜色和字体,对页面的内容进行布局...-- 内容在这 --> 因为浏览器执行 HTML 文件,是从上而下执行...:JavaScript 代码可以直接在 Console 控制台执行, Chrome 浏览器开发者工具,快捷键 F12JavaScript 声明及命名规则直接量(literal),程序中直接使用数据值变量...(variable),变量是使用 var 关键字定义一个存储空间,直接量储存起来,方便调用JavaScript 变量是松散类型(弱类型),可以用来保存任何类型数据, C 语言当中,我们定义整型变量会使用到...= b;等于 == 情况下,只要值相同就返回 True全等 === 时候,需要值和类型都要匹配才能返回 True赋值运算符 = 并不是等于,如果我想把 5 这个值赋值变量 a,那么写法应该是:a=

1.2K50

美团前端面试题集锦_2023-02-28

,b赋值为3,b此时是一个全局变量,而将3赋值a,a是一个局部变量,所以最后打印时候,a仍旧是undefined。...懒加载实现原理是,页面上图片 src 属性设置为空字符串,图片真实路径保存在一个自定义属性,当页面滚动时候,进行判断,如果图片进入页面可视区域内,则从自定义属性取出真实路径赋值图片...什么叫变量对象? 变量对象是 js 代码进入执行上下文时,js 引擎在内存建立一个对象,用来存放当前执行环境变量。 2....} /**ps: 执行第一行代码之前,函数声明已经创建完成.后面的对之前声明进行了覆盖。**/ 检查当前环境变量声明并赋值为undefined。...但 add 函数定义仍然存在,因为它返回并赋值了 sum 变量。 (ps: 这才是闭包产生变量存于内存当中真相) 接下来就是简单执行过程,不再赘述。。

96830

JS设置定时器_js设置定时器

ps:定时器id配发是递增,从1开始累加,但是有一个小细节,就是当你一次页面运行过程,打个比方,你创建了第五个定时器,它id为5,然后你把它销毁,再创建一个定时器,那么这个定时器编号会是6...= function (){ /*这里有个小细节,如果使用let或者var来定义变量,那么得到变量是局部变量,而如果不使用直接写那么得到就是全局变量 然后这里使用JS循环定时器,每100ms...定时器编号机制之后修改出来结果,仍然使用b作为容器,但是这次我们先给b赋值赋值一个系统永远不会分配给定时器编号数字那就是-100,然后在按下暂停键之后,虽然定时器本身值已经变为null但是并未赋值...b,那我们自己再b赋值一个不同于-100负数-50,这样我们再次按下start时候,只要判断一下b是否等于-100或者-50即可,因为如果存在一个定时器,那么b里面就一定是一个正整数 <script...,通过控制b和c这两个变量增加,通过一些设计实现如果他们相差1那么就允许创建定时器,如果已经有定时器存在,那么他们就相等。

29.9K30

javaScript学习笔记(一)js基础

一、简介 1、概述: JavaScript是目前web开发不可缺少脚本语言,js不需要编译即可运行,运行在客户端,需要通过浏览器来解析执行JavaScript代码。...(3)DOM:Document Object Model(文档对象模型),此处文档暂且理解为htmlhtml加载到浏览器内存,可以使用jsDOM技术对内存html节点进行修改,用户从浏览器看到是... alert(“内嵌式”) 5.2、外链式: 首先新建一个文件类型为.js文件,然后该文件js语句,通过script标签对引入到html页面。...js是弱类型语言,不重视类型定义,但js会根据为变量赋值情况自定判断该变量是何种类型: 数值型:var i = 1; var d = 2.35; 字符串:var str = "用心学习"; 布尔型:...function(形式参数){函数体} 调用方式:匿名函数赋值一个变量通过变量名调用函数 定义函数并赋值变量:var fn = function(形式参数){函数体} 调用函数:fn(实际参数

2.7K30

jQuery源码浅析

闭包:js函数对象不仅包含函数代码逻辑,还引用了当前作用域链, 函数对象可以通过作用域链相互关联起来,函数体内部变量都可以保存在函数作用域内 这种特性计算机科学文献称为闭包,所有的js函数都是闭包...javascript运行在它被定义作用域里,而不是执行作用域里 关于js作用域参见 : http://www.laruence.com/2009/05/28/863.html 废话少说,上滥代码 <...* 1.jQuery里可以把window对象当局部变量使用 * 2.压缩时候window变量名可以压缩至1个字节 */ var getProto = Object.getPrototypeOf...,This关键字永远都指向函数(方法)所有者) this指向是jQuery.fn * 这里简单DOM对象赋值this[0],其他属性省略, 我们使用jQuery时候使用下标...return this; }; /** * 这一句很关键 * jQuery.fn赋值jQuery.fn.init原型,这样jQuery.fn.init

90130

JS】预编译详解

Git专栏:Git篇 JavaScript专栏:js实用技巧篇,该专栏持续更新,目的是大家分享一些常用实用技巧,同时巩固自己基础,共同进步,欢迎前来交流 你一键三连是对我最大支持 ❤️...) 闭包是由作用域产生一种现象 JS 中所有函数都是闭包 内部作用域能访问外部,取决于函数定义位置,和调用无关 作用域内定义变量、函数声明会提升到作用域顶部——预编译;JS只有var和function...,如果未经声明就赋值(js语言特性,相反c++未经声明变量无法使用),此变量就归全局对象所有 一切声明全局变量,全是 window 属性 broswer环境输出: 小例子...b,再将b赋值a;虽然a、b是函数作用域中,但由于b未经声明,所以下面browser环境输出结果表明b window 属性,而 a 则不会出现在全局对象;函数demo声明是全局作用域...未声明变量赋值,实际就是全局对象属性赋值,参考前文预编译 所有的全局变量、全局函数都会附加到全局对象 这称之为全局污染,又称之为全局暴露,或简称污染、暴露 如果要避免污染,

1.2K20

ReactJSX理解

简单来说,JSX可以很好描述页面html结构,很方便Jshtml代码,并具有Js全部功能。...React元素需要大写字母开头,或者元素赋值大小字母开头变量,小写字母将被认为是HTML标签。 不能使用表达式作为React元素类型,需要先将其赋值大写字母开头变量,再把该变量作为组件。...JSX使用 示例我们声明了一个名为name变量,然后JSX中使用它,并将它包裹在大括号JSX语法,可以大括号内放置任何有效JavaScript表达式。...也就是说,你可以if语句和for循环代码块中使用JSX,JSX赋值变量,把JSX当作参数传入,以及从函数返回JSX。...; } 通常可以通过使用引号来属性值指定为字符串字面量,也可以使用大括号来属性值插入一个JavaScript表达式,属性嵌入JavaScript表达式时,不要在大括号外面加上引号。

2.4K20

133 - 修炼 - 小程序知识点05

开发通常会显示一些值,比如文本框值。这个时候怎么做呢?通常需要写一大段JS赋值,简单来说也就是2步,首先获得文本框对象,然后通过对象value属性赋值。...而在小程序,有一个更加节省成本方法,也就是更方便方法。一个值使用一段变量进行绑定,JS再对该变量进行赋值。这个对数据进行赋值解决方案,就叫做数据绑定。...嗯哼,咋一看,这两种方式好像都么有什么区别,都是通过变量修改文本值呀。原先方式是需要获得每一个标签对象,然后通过对象属性修改对象值。..."; 省去了寻找对象,就可以不限于标签赋值了。...还可以用这种方式对标签属性赋值。 那这和WXML又有什么联系呢?WXML类似于HTML,是一门标签语言,数据绑定就是对它里面的标签内容和属性做修改。

50910

前端|Js基础知识介绍

解决方案 2.1 在网页插入js方法 在网页插入js方法有三种,即:直接加入HTML文档,连接脚本文件,HTML标签内添加脚本。...(1)直接加入HTML文档:就是js脚本程序包括HTML,使其成为HTML文档一部分。...=”文件名.js”> (3) HTML标签内添加脚本 事例: <input name="btn" type="button" value="弹出消息框" onclick=...JS函数,大家把它想象成JAVA中方法即可理解,函数作用:完成任务代码块"封装”起来,供其他调用方无限制使用。...(1)var:用于声明变量关键字 ①先声明变量赋值 ②同时声明和赋值变量 ③不声明直接赋值 var color;color=red;var color=red;color=red; (2)

1.1K10
领券